As Bitcoin initiates a significant recovery phase following its 2025 peak, institutional investors are shifting focus toward equity proxies like MicroStrategy and Coinbase. These 'leveraged beta' plays offer a way to capture outsized returns through traditional financial structures without the complexities of direct digital asset custody.
President Donald Trump met with Coinbase CEO Brian Armstrong just hours before launching a public critique of the banking industry's stance on pending cryptocurrency legislation. The timing suggests a significant alignment between the administration and major crypto exchanges on the controversial issue of stablecoin yields.
